RR Auction: Fine Autographs and Artifacts Featuring WWII

Auction Details

RR Auction's August Fine Autographs and Artifacts sale is highlighted by a special World War II section, which features classic hand-painted A-2 leather flight jackets, a remarkable naval dispatch about Pearl Harbor, and extraordinary letters by its leading figures (Dwight D. Eisenhower, Omar Bradley, George S. Patton, and Douglas MacArthur). Other top lots span a dozen genres, and include an autograph letter by President Abraham Lincoln, a fully signed Led Zeppelin III album, autographs of Apollo 11 astronauts Neil Armstrong, Buzz Aldrin, and Michael Collins, and a comprehensive Frank Lloyd Wright architectural archive.
